I signed my two lines up with MCI as well and am getting all of the miles promised. I live in Colorado, not one of the nine states apparently elligible for the promo.

This is something I don't think I've seen yet...

when I switched from MCI to Sprint for the original Worldperks 16k mile offer several months back, I switched back to MCI for the 25k mile deal (with Delta), but I asked Sprint to keep my Foncard active.

About two weeks ago, I got a call from Sprint wanting to confirm my Worldperks number. They didn't ask me to switch back, it was just a confirmation call. Why, I don't know. I didn't tell them I had switched to MCI.

So I checked my Worldperks account and sure enough, Sprint is still sending miles to my Worldperks account. I am using the Foncard occasionally, so I suppose it still shows in their records that I'm a customer. The Foncard is free, by the way, so those Worldperk miles are really cheap! http://talk.flyertalk.com/forum/smile.gif

I live in the suburbs of Chicago & I have 4 lines currently receiving 25K miles & 2 I'll soon be switching back to MCI. The trick is that you have to set them up separately. If you try to do more than one at a time you'll only get 1000 miles for the second line. The other draw back is that you will spend a lot of time on the phone waiting. 25K miles per line is well worth the wait though.
